Choosing the Right Outdoor Dog Chair

Finding the perfect dog chair for outside involves considering your dog’s size, breed, and personality, as well as your own aesthetic preferences and practical needs. A small dog might prefer a cozy, cushioned chair, while a larger breed might benefit from a sturdy, elevated cot-style design. Consider the materials, portability, and ease of cleaning when making your selection. A durable, weather-resistant material is essential for outdoor use. Is your dog a chewer? Opt for a chair made from robust materials that can withstand some wear and tear.

Factors to Consider When Buying Dog Chairs for Outside

  • Size and Breed: Measure your dog to ensure a comfortable fit. A chair that’s too small will be cramped, while one that’s too large may not provide adequate support.
  • Material: Look for weather-resistant materials like durable canvas, powder-coated steel, or UV-resistant plastic.
  • Portability: If you plan to travel with the chair, consider a lightweight and foldable design.
  • Ease of Cleaning: Choose a chair with removable and washable covers for easy maintenance.
  • Elevated vs. Ground Level: Elevated chairs offer better airflow and can keep your dog cool in warm weather.

Benefits of Outdoor Dog Chairs

Providing your dog with their own outdoor chair offers several benefits:

  • Comfort and Support: Dog chairs can provide a comfortable and supportive place for your dog to rest, especially for older dogs or those with joint issues.
  • Cleanliness: Keeps your dog off the ground, away from dirt, bugs, and potential allergens.
  • Portability: Take your dog’s favorite seat with you on camping trips, picnics, or to the beach.
  • Elevated View: Elevated chairs offer a better vantage point for your dog to observe their surroundings.

Types of Dog Chairs for Outside

Elevated Cot-Style Chairs

These chairs are raised off the ground, providing good airflow and keeping your dog cool. They’re ideal for warm weather and can help prevent overheating.

Portable Folding Chairs

Perfect for travel and on-the-go adventures, these chairs are lightweight and easy to fold and store.

Plush Cushioned Chairs

These chairs offer maximum comfort and are ideal for pampered pooches. Look for chairs with removable and washable covers for easy cleaning.
